A practical seminar led by experienced professionals in complex commercial litigation. Harvin D. Pitch (Senior Partner at Teplitsky, Colson LLP) and Alan Mak (Senior Director at Ferguson + Mak LLP) will cover a range of contemporary damages quantification issues that will help you become more effective in performing your vital role in the judicial process. Topics will include:
Getting to the witness box: Expert independence and objectivity; Working relationships with legal counsel
Setting the Bar – Proving Profits and Earnings Capacity: Defining lost economic capacity; Isolating the effect of contributory factors
Scope of Review: When litigation strategy compromises an expert’s analysis; Working within and around restrictions to information
